Kashmir Files director Vivek Agnihotri wants to do Mahabharata, saying, “I want to do the character…”

The famous film director of The Kashmir Files, Vivek Agnihotri is soon to release his upcoming movie The Vaccine War. Before that, he made another big announcement. Vivek Agnihotri has said that he is now considering making a film about the Mahabharata.

Recently, Vivek Agnihotri’s documentary series The Kashmir Files Unreported was released on the OTT platform G5. After that, the director has now stated that he wants to make a film based on the Indian epic Mahabharata and he is considering it very seriously.


In an interview with Times Now, Vivek Agnihotri said that he has spent his entire life reading, researching, analyzing and incorporating his life into his speeches. He said that if he had to make films about mythology now, he would make them like history.

Vivek said, “Other people do everything for the box office, but I will do it for the people, other people made Arjun, Bheem and others exaggerate.” For me, however, Mahabharata is a battle between dharma and adharma.


Speaking of Vivek Agnihotri’s next film, The Vaccine War: A True Story, which hits theaters on September 28th this year. Agnihotri himself announced this on the occasion of Independence Day. Sharing some glimpses of the film on Instagram, he wrote in the caption, “Date Announcement: Dear Friends, Your film The Vaccine War: A True Story will be released worldwide on the auspicious day of September 28, 2023.” Please bless us.
